linux怎么开放关闭端口
linux怎么开放关闭端口详细介绍
在 Linux 系统中,开放和关闭端口通常会涉及到防火墙的操作。不同的 Linux 发行版使用的防火墙管理工具可能不同,下面主要介绍基于iptables和firewalld这两种常见工具的端口开放和关闭方法。
1. 使用
iptables
iptables是一个广泛使用的 Linux 防火墙工具,不过在一些较新的系统中,它可能被更高级的工具所替代。
开放端口
要开放一个端口(例如 8080),你可以执行以下命令:
bash
iptables INPUT tcp ACCEPT
iptables save
关闭端口
要关闭之前开放的端口,你可以执行以下命令:
bash
iptables INPUT tcp ACCEPT
iptables save
2. 使用
firewalld
firewalld是许多现代 Linux 发行版(如 CentOS 7 及以上、Fedora 等)默认使用的防火墙管理工具。
开放端口
要开放一个端口(例如 8080),你可以执行以下命令:
bash
firewall-cmd --add-port/tcp
firewall-cmd
关闭端口
要关闭之前开放的端口,你可以执行以下命令:
bash
firewall-cmd --remove-port/tcp
firewall-cmd
总结
- 若你的系统使用的是较旧的版本,或者你熟悉
iptables,可以使用iptables来管理端口。 - 若你的系统是较新的版本,建议使用
firewalld,它提供了更方便的配置方式和动态管理功能。